검색결과

검색조건
좁혀보기
검색필터
결과 내 재검색

간행물

    분야

      발행연도

      -

        검색결과 15

        1.
        2018.06 KCI 등재 서비스 종료(열람 제한)
        스크린 기반 게임은 여러 공간에 옮겨가면서 설치해야 하는 경우가 자주 일어난다. 이 경우에 센서에 변화가 생기거나 공간의 구성 차이로 설치에 어려움이 생길 수 있다. 또한 실제 게임과 똑같이 경험하는 것도 의미가 있지만 난이도를 조절하여 더 많은 재미를 느낄 수 있도록 유도해 야 하는 경우도 존재한다. 본 논문에서는 스크린 골프와 유사한 형태의 체감형 게임인 스크린 양궁 게임을 개발하는 과정에서 공간의 변화에 따른 설치를 쉽게 하는 기법, 사용자의 실력에 따라 게임의 난이도를 자동으로 조절할 수 있는 방법을 설명하고 실험 결과를 보이고자 한다.
        2.
        2017.02 KCI 등재 서비스 종료(열람 제한)
        최근 실시간으로 모션블러(motion blur)를 위한 연구들은 픽셀당 여러개의 시간 색상을 계산 한 후 평균내는 방식으로 샘플의 수가 적을 경우 아티펙트(artifacts)나 노이즈(noise)가 발생하 는 문제를 가지고 있다. 본 논문은 이러한 문제를 개선하기 위해서 이동궤적 근사 다면체 (motion trail)를 이용한 실시간 모션블러 알고리즘을 제안한다. 본 논문의 알고리즘에서는 현재 프레임과 이전프레임의 삼각형으로 이동궤적 근사 다면체를 만들고 전후 관계(front-to-back) 정렬방법과 시공간차원의 비트연산(bitwise operation)을 적용하여 여러 물체가 겹치는 순간의 가시성 문제를 해결했다. 결과적으로 가려지지 않은 이동궤적 근사 다면체만을 그리기에 매끄 러운 블러 효과를 얻는다.
        3.
        2016.08 KCI 등재 서비스 종료(열람 제한)
        잠입 액션 게임은 크게 적을 공격해 잠입하거나 적의 시야를 회피하는 두 가지 방식으로 진 행된다. 최근의 잠입 액션 게임은 높은 액션의 비중으로 전면대결의 빈도가 높아져 다른 액션 게임 장르와의 경계가 흐려졌다. 본 논문에서는 플레이어를 약자의 위치에 두어 액션을 이용한 잠입이 아닌 회피를 이용한 잠입을 주된 특징으로 하는 게임을 제작하고 그 제작과정을 기술한 다. 회피를 위한 주요 요소로 빛을 선택해 적의 시야를 차단하여 회피하는 것을 주된 플레이 방법으로 삼았고 액션 요소를 추가하기 위해 다양한 프로토타입을 제작하여 테스터들에게 플레 이하도록 하는 플레이 테스트를 거쳤고, 그 결과 제한된 상황에서의 액션이 선택되었으며, 잠입 에 영향을 주는 사용자 인테페이스 중 미니맵, 입력 장치가 추가, 수정되었다. 잠입을 이용한 게임 제작 시 결정된 여러 사항들을 살펴보고 그 결정과정의 경험을 기술한다.
        4.
        2016.04 KCI 등재 서비스 종료(열람 제한)
        간접조명은 실제감에 많은 도움을 주지만 많은 계산량이 필요하기 때문에 실시간 전역조명에서는 적용되기 힘들었다. 특히 2차광원에서의 가시성을 계산하기위해서는 각 광원에 대해서 모든 물체들 을 처리해야 하기 때문에 계산량이 많다. 본 논문에서는 움직이지 않는 물체들의 가시성을 재활용 하여 움직이는 물체가 많지 않을 경우 효율적이면서도 2차광원의 가시성을 활용하는 간접조명 알고 리즘을 제안한다. 기존 방법에 비해서 정확하면서도 효율적인 2차광원 가시성을 바탕으로 보다 복 잡한 장면에서 사실적인 간접조명을 실시간에 가능하게 한다.
        5.
        2015.08 KCI 등재 서비스 종료(열람 제한)
        게임의 난이도는 게임의 재미와 깊은 연관이 있다. 하지만 게임 레벨의 난이도를 적절하게 결정 하는 것은 쉽지 않다. 대부분의 경우 사람의 실제 게임 플레이를 통한 테스트가 요구한다. 또한 정 량적인 평가도 어렵다. 따라서 게임 레벨 난이도의 정량적 평가를 자동으로 수행하는 것은 게임 개 발에 많은 도움이 될 것이다. 이 논문에서는 경로 탐색 알고리즘을 사용하여 게임 레벨의 길 찾기 난이도를 평가하였다. 길을 찾는 것은 많은 게임들의 기본 속성으로 게임 레벨의 전반적인 난이도 를 대표한다. 그리고 우리는 게임 레벨의 탐색 가능 영역이 동적으로 확장되고 다시금 탐색이 요구 되는 경우 이전 경로 탐색 결과를 재사용하여 난이도 평가 알고리즘의 성능을 최적화하였다.
        6.
        2015.06 KCI 등재 서비스 종료(열람 제한)
        본 논문에서는 망각곡선을 응용한 반복학습시기 설정 및 학습자 수준과 단어 난이도 자동계산 방법이 적용된 영어단어 암기시스템을 소개한다. 우리 시스템은 망각곡선을 사용해서 학습자의 단어암기 횟수에 따라 적절한 반복 주기를 정하고 그 시기에 복습을 요구한다. 학습자가 알고 있는 단어들에 대한 복습시간을 없애고 잊어버릴 확률이 가장 높은 단어들을 우선 적으로 복습하는 것으로 시간을 절약 할 수 있는 것이다. 또 수준에 맞는 난이도의 단어들을 제공함으로써 학습 흥미와 성취도 유지에 기여할 수 있다. 학습자의 수준을 고려하지 않은 난이도의 단어를 무작위로 제공하거나 이미 다른 사람들의 평가에 맞춰진 난이도의 단어들을 제공하는 기존의 시스템과 차별되도록 학습자와 단어 난이도 설정에 온라인 체스게임 랭킹시스템에서 사용하고 있는 "Glicko" 시스템을 적용시켰다. 플레이어간의 대결을 통해서 서로의 실력이 결정되고 매칭되는 이 시스템을 우리는 단어와 사람간의 대결로 시스템에 적용하였다. 그것으로 인해 학습하는 사람의 수준과 단어들의 난이도가 실시간으로 측정되고 학습과정에 반영이 된다. 이 외에 부가적으로 분산학습, 시험형식의 문제풀이의 즉각적인 피드백을 활용하여 영어 단어 암기의 효율성을 극대화 한다.
        7.
        2014.04 KCI 등재 서비스 종료(열람 제한)
        면광원에 의한 부드러운 그림자의 표현은 가상 장면을 보다 사실적으로 보이도록 한다. 하지만 부드러운 그림자의 계산은 매우 느리게 수행되기 때문에 실시간 3차원 응용 프로그램에 적용하기 위해서는 가속화가 요구된다. 우리는 기존의 실시간 부드러운 그림자 방법들이 가정했던 면광원의 모양과 색상을 보다 일반적으로 확장하여 임의의 모양과 색상을 갖는 면광원에 대한 부드러운 그림자 생성 방법을 제안한다. 그림자 매핑 정보를 획득할 수 있는 그림자 맵은 픽셀과 면광원 간의 가시성 검사를 근사하기 위해 사용되며 픽셀 주변의 그림자 복잡도에 따라 근사의 정도를 결정하였다. 그 결과 보다 일반적인 형태와 색상의 면광원에 대한 부드러운 그림자를 실시간에 표현할 수 있었다.
        8.
        2013.06 KCI 등재 서비스 종료(열람 제한)
        이 논문은 공간 증강 현실 콘텐츠를 낮은 비용과 빠른 속도로 제작하기 위한 프레임워크를 제안한다. 우리의 프레임워크는 구하기 쉬운 장비인 웹캠과 프로젝터만으로 투영 기반의 증강현실 콘텐츠를 제작할 수 있는 환경을 제공한다. 콘텐츠 제작자는 웹캠과 프로젝터를 설치하고 프레임워크에서 제공하는 인터페이스를 조작하는 것으로 쉽고 빠르게 공간 증강 현실 기술을 사용한 디지털 콘텐츠를 제작할 수 있다. 기존의 솔루션들은 고가인 경우가 많고 콘텐츠 제작자가 증강 현실 기술을 스스로 적용하는 것이 쉽지 않기 때문에 우리가 제안하는 프레임워크는 콘텐츠 제작자가 콘텐츠 내용 자체에 집중할 수 있도록 돕는다. 프레임워크를 통해 웹캠과 프로젝터를 한 번 설정하면 인식 가능한 실제 물체의 이동과 회전에 따른 가상 물체의 렌더링 결과를 올바르게 투영한다. 그 결과, 우리는 사실적인 증강현실 콘텐츠를 확인할 수 있다.
        9.
        2011.02 KCI 등재 서비스 종료(열람 제한)
        본 논문에서는 주성분 분석을 사용한 포토모자이크 생성 기법을 제안한다. 후보 이미지 집합의 주성분 분석 결과인 주성분과 계수를 사용하여 후보 이미지 검색을 보다 빠르고 정확하게 포토모자이크를 생성한다. 두 이미지를 하나의 주성분으로 투영해서 계산된 두 계수가 유사하면 두 이미지의 본래 정보 역시 유사하기 때문에, 본 논문에서 제안하는 주성분 분석을 사용하는 계수 비교 방법은 이미지의 색상 정보와 위치 정보를 동시에 비교할 수 있다. 계수 비교 방법은 모든 색상 비교 방법보다 빠르고, 평균 색상 비교 방법보다 정확하게 포토모자이크를 생성한다. 본 논문에서 제안하는 포토모자이크 알고리즘은 그래픽스 하드웨어의 가속을 받아 수행되므로 실시간에 입력 영상을 처리할 수 있다.
        10.
        2009.10 KCI 등재 서비스 종료(열람 제한)
        이 논문은 피하산란의 정도가 다를 것으로 예상되는 얼굴의 6개의 부위를 촬영하여 각각의 산란특성을 추출하고 렌더링에 반영하여 얼굴의 사실감 있는 표현이 가능한 방법을 제안한다. 각 부위별 산란이미지는 프로젝터로부터 피부에 입사된 단위광선이 내부 산란을 거쳐 밖으로 드러나는 모양을 여러 노출로 촬영하여 HDR 이미지로 합성하고, 비선형 최소제곱합의 해법 중 Sequential Quadratic Programming을 이용하여 광선의 입사지점을 지나는 단면이 이루는 곡선에 '가우스 함수의 선형결합'을 적합한다. 가우스 함수는 산란곡선을 잘 근사하면서 필터로서 적용이 쉬운 장점을 가진다. 우리는 최소제곱합의 해가 지역 해에 빠지는 않도록 유전알고리듬을 이용해 초기 값을 설정한다. 근사된 식의 각 가우스 항은 얼굴에 입사되는 복사조도를 렌더링한 텍스처에 가우스 필터로 적용되어 피하산란효과를 표현. 이 논문에서는 최대 12회의 가우스 필터링을 효율적으로 처리하기 위해 쿠다의 병렬처리능력를 활용하였다.
        11.
        2009.06 KCI 등재 서비스 종료(열람 제한)
        본 논문에서는 빛이 옷감 내부에서 산란되어 나타나는 패턴을 측정하고 이를 이용해 옷감을 표현하는 새로운 형태의 렌더링 방법을 제안한다. 지금까지는 BTF(Bidirectional Texture Function)가 옷감과 같은 구조를 표현할 수 있는 최적의 방법으로 생각되어져 왔다. 하지만 BTF에 의한 재질 복원은 그 품질이 측정된 데이터의 양에 비례하고, 측정된 데이터를 각종 빛의 현상이 통합된 상태로 사용해야 한다는 단점을 지닌다. 우리는 옷감 구조 내에서의 빛의 산란현상이 옷감의 색감을 드러내는데 중요한 역할을 하고 있음을 확인하였다. 이러한 사실을 이용하여 어떤 지점에 입사된 단위광선이 옷감 내부의 메소구조와 섬유를 통과하면서 외부로 나타나는 산란패턴(산란이미지:Scatter Image)을 샘플의 충분히 많은 지점에서 획득하고, 각 임의의 지점의 밝기는 그 주변 지점에서 현 픽셀까지 도달하는 빛의 양을 합하여 결정한다. 본 논문은 제안하는 방법은 옷감의 각 지점에 입사되는 광선을 개별적으로 조절 가능케 하여 옷감과 같이 내부 산란이 불규칙한 패턴을 보이는 재질을 더욱 사실적으로 표현할 수 있도록 하는 단서를 제공한다.
        12.
        2009.04 KCI 등재 서비스 종료(열람 제한)
        본 논문에서는 정성적, 정량적 측정을 통한 게임 감성 유희(遊戱)요소 도출을 목적으로, 공포게임의 '공포'를 '유희적 공포'라 보고 로제카이와의 놀이이론에 근거하여 분석한 후, 이를 바탕으로 공포게임 내 '유희적 공포요소'를 4가지로 분류했다. 연구자는 플레이어의 반응을 통해 이를 검증하기 위해 실증적 실험을 수행하였는데, 실험은 공포게임을 플레이 하는 동안 심박계를 통해서 각 실험자들의 심박을 측정하고 이를 촬영한 비디오 데이타를 분석하여 유희적 공포요소가 심리적, 생리적인 영향을 줄 것이라 예측된 지점을 공포지점(fear point)이라 명명하였으며, 이 지점에서 측정된 심박이 평상시 평균심박 및 실험 중 평균심박과 통계적으로 유의한 차가 있는지 알아보고 설문을 통한 플레이어의 주관적 데이타를 첨부하여 심박수와의 통계적인 상관관계를 알아보았다. 연구 결과, 공포지점에서 실험자들의 심박이 평상시 심박 및 실험 중 평균심박 보다 통계적으로 유의미하게 상승됨을 증명했으며, 주관적 데이터와도 상관관계가 높음을 보여주었다. 또한 게임 내용 분석결과 본 연구에서 주장하는 유희적 공포요소가 해당 지점에서 실험자들의 심리, 생리적 반응에 주요한 역할을 하였음을 알 수 있었다. 본 연구는 게임내 유희적 요소로서의 공포요소를 이론적인 방법과 실증적인 방법을 통해 검증하고 앞으로의 게임 제작 및 기획에 도움이 되는 기준을 제시할 수 있었다.
        13.
        2007.12 KCI 등재 서비스 종료(열람 제한)
        이 논문에서는 다양한 종류의 응용프로그램에 바로 적용할 수 있는 GPU 레이캐스팅 기법에 기반 하는 효율적인 실시간 지형 렌더링 방법을 제안한다. 여기에서 제안되는 방법은 별도의 메시 구조 없이 이미지(높이맵) 만으로 지형을 표현하는 것이 가능하며, 공중과 지상에서의 활동이 자유로워 가상현실은 물론 게임에 바로 사용할 수 있다. 메시에 기반 하지 않으므로 별도의 LOD조절이 필요하지 않으며, 높이맵과 컬러맵의 해상도에 따라 기하표현의 정밀도와 화질이 결정된다 더욱이 GPU-only 기법은 CPU가 더 일반적인 작업 에 집중할 수 있도록 함으로써 시스템의 전반적인 성능을 향상시킨다. 지금까지 높이맵을 사용한 많은 지형렌더링 관련 연구는 대부분이 상당부분 CPU 의존하거나 그 응용범위를 비행 시뮬레이션 등에 제한하여 왔다. 우리는 기존의 변위매핑 기법을 개선하여 지형 렌더링에 적용함으로써 기존 폴리곤기반 기법에서 나타나던 크랙이나 팝핑 등의 문제점들을 근본적으로 배제하였다. 이 논문이 기여하는 바는 지표면 탐색(walk-through)시의 임의 시선에 대한 효율적 처리와 높이장(height field)의 곡면 재구성을 통한 화질의 획기적인 개선이다. 우리는 재구성된 곡면과 시선의 교차점을 계산하는 효율적인 방법을 제시한다. 우리가 제안하고 있는 알고리듬은100% GPU에서 구현되었으며, 256×226~4096×4096까지의 다양한 해상도에서 실험한 결과 초당 수십~수백 프레임을 얻었다.
        14.
        2007.06 KCI 등재 서비스 종료(열람 제한)
        물체 내부에서의 빛의 산란 현상 (subsurface scattering)에 기반한 조명 모델은 사실적인 이미지 생성에서 매우 중요하지만, 복잡한 계산으로 인하여 게임, 가상현실 등의 대화형 환경에 적용되기 어려웠다. 우리는 빛의 단일 산란과 다중 산란 현상에 의한 조명을 이미지 상에서 근사하는 보다 실용적인 기법을 제안한다. 먼저 광원 시점에서 렌더링한 이미지의 각 픽셀에 물체 내부로 투과된 조사도 정보를 저장하고, 쉐이딩 단계에서 이 정보를 사용하여 조명을 빠르게 계산한다. 단일 산란은 그림자 매핑과 유사한 알고리즘과 적응적인 결정적 샘플링을 통해 수행 비용을 효율적으로 줄인다. 다중 산란은 빛의 확산 이론에 기반한 계층적인 샘플링을 사용한다. 복잡한 함수의 테이블화은 속도를 보다 향상 시킨다. 실험을 통해 제안된 기법이 초당 수 십에서 수 백 프레임의 빠른 속도로 사실감있는 장면을 렌더링할 수 있으며, 게임과 같은 기존의 대화형 환경에 쉽게 적용될 수 있음을 보여준다.
        15.
        2007.03 KCI 등재 서비스 종료(열람 제한)
        피부, 옷 등 실세계의 대부분의 물질들은 반투명한 재질로 되어있고, 부드러운 외양을 띄고 있다. 본 논문에서는 GPU 기반의 계층화 알고리즘을 통해, 양극 확산 (dipole diffusion) 기법에 기반한 표면 내에서의 빛의 산란에 의한 조명을 근사하여 반투명한 재질을 실시간에 렌더링하는 기법을 제안한다. 무수히 많은 수의 픽셀 빛 입자들은 GPU를 활용하여 쿼드트리로 계층화된다. 렌더링될 각 픽셀마다, 많은 빛 입자를 대신하여 좋은 화질로 근사할 수 있는 집합들을 선택하고, 이것을 사용하여 조명을 계산한다. 우리는 또한, 고해상도 이미지를 효율적으로 렌더링하기 위해 공간적 일관성과 early-z 컬링을 이용한 계층적 화면 보간 기법을 소개한다. 이를 위하여, 화면 정보를 GPU 상에서 계층화한다. 우리는 공간적 유사도가 높은 픽셀들을 하나의 픽셀로 렌더링함으로써 적응적으로 보간한다. 실험을 통해 빛 계층화를 통해 반투명한 물체를 실시간에 렌더링할 수 있음을 확인하였다. 화면 보간 기법은 동급 화질에서 렌더링 비용을 2~4배 정도 감소시켰다. 모든 과정은 GPU를 사용한 이미지 공간 상에서 빠르게 수행되며, 어떠한 긴 전처리과정도 필요하지 않는다.